|
马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。
您需要 登录 才可以下载或查看,没有帐号?立即注册
x
ASP.NET和ASP的比较,技术上比较已经没什么可说的了.新一代在大部分程度来说当然是比旧一代好了.关键看你对所做软件的理解了.因人而定.会写的话也可能比ASP.NET写得更有效率和更方便重用treeview|web|把持TreeView是MicrosoftIEWebControls中很有效的控件,使用普遍。跟着TreeView翻开和收拢,它所实践占有的高度也在变更,我的一个项目中,必要TreeviewControl的高度随之变更,构成“松散”的结构。完成办法以下:
1、修正treeview.htc
treeview.htc在http://localhost/webctrl_client/1_0/中,到场以下几行:
<public:propertyname="TreeviewNode"GET="getTreeviewNode"/>
functiongetTreeviewNode()
{
returntreeviewNode;
}
这是为了将埋没的属性传送出来。
2、界说javascript函数
functionAthosGetTreeViewCompactHeight(TreeviewID)
{
objTreeview=document.all[TreeviewID];
objTreeviewNode=objTreeview.TreeviewNode;
objTreeviewDivs=objTreeviewNode.getElementsByTagName("DIV");
iCount=objTreeviewDivs.length;
CompactHeight=-1;
for(i=0;i<iCount;i++)
{
objTreeviewDiv=objTreeviewDivs[i];
iTop=objTreeviewDiv.offsetTop;
iHeight=objTreeviewDiv.offsetHeight;
iBottom=iTop+iHeight;
if(iBottom>CompactHeight)
CompactHeight=iBottom;
}
returnCompactHeight;
}
functionAthosFitTreeViewHeight(TreeviewID)
{
objTreeview=document.all[TreeviewID];
objTreeview.style.height=String(AthosGetTreeViewCompactHeight(TreeviewID))+"px";
}
第一个函数,是获得树的实践高度。第二个函数,是从头设定树控件的高度。参数则都是树控件的id。
如许,就能够把持树控件的高度了。
//athossmth版权一切,转载请与作者接洽。
</p>因为现在数据库都使用标准的SQL语言对数据库进行管理,所以如果是标准SQL语言,两者基本上都可以通用的。SQLServer还有更多的扩展,可以用存储过程,数据库大小无极限限制。 |
|